Output d30a06304eda0ffd25d24a75acd4f973ef5a3c228722efa36c46e97df7a2cf9c: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a8e1cd7be775d73877b33d9ee787291e9f63ea OP_EQUAL
address
3QMopFKQYMF1btMZ534uuHL8QyoWaa7G2w
transaction
d30a06304eda0ffd25d24a75acd4f973ef5a3c228722efa36c46e97df7a2cf9c
confirmations
346768
spent
true